Retaining Wall Replacement in Sonoma County, CA

Retaining wall replacement services involve removing existing retaining structures and installing new ones to support soil, prevent erosion, and improve landscape stability. These projects typically address issues such as wall failure, significant damage from weather, or outdated materials that no longer meet safety or aesthetic needs. Homeowners often request this service when their current retaining walls no longer effectively hold back soil, or when they want to update their landscape with more durable or visually appealing materials.

Before requesting a retaining wall repl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the purpose of the wall, the type of soil and slope on their property, and the desired materials for the new structure. It’s also helpful to understand any local regulations or permits that may be required for construction.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with property needs and complies with local standards, resulting in a stable and attractive landscape feature.

FAQ

Retaining Wall Replacement Questions

What are common reasons to replace a retaining wall? Signs such as leaning, cracking, or bulging indicate the need for replacement to ensure stability and safety.

What types of materials are used for retaining wall replacement? Common options include concrete, natural stone, and timber, chosen based on property needs and aesthetic preferences.

How does a property owner know if a retaining wall is failing? Visible movement, soil erosion, or water pooling behind the wall are key indicators of failure.

What projects typically involve retaining wall replacement? Projects often include hillside stabilization, garden terracing, or yard leveling to improve property safety and appearance.
